How Plumbers Improve Water Quality

1. Installing Water Filtration Systems

Plumbers can install whole-house or point-of-use filtration systems to remove contaminants such as chlorine, lead, and sediment from your water supply.

  • Common Types:
    • Carbon filters for taste and odor improvement.
    • Reverse osmosis systems for advanced purification.

2. Replacing Outdated Pipes

Old pipes made of lead or galvanized steel can leach harmful substances into your water. Plumbers replace these pipes with safer materials like PEX or copper.

3. Flushing Water Heaters

Sediment buildup in water heaters can affect water quality, leading to discoloration or foul odors. Regular flushing by a plumber helps maintain clean, high-quality hot water.

4. Repairing Leaks

Leaks in pipes can introduce contaminants from surrounding soil or structures into your water supply. Plumbers can detect and repair leaks to prevent contamination.

5. Addressing Hard Water Issues

Plumbers install water softeners to reduce the effects of hard water, which can leave mineral deposits in pipes and appliances, affecting both water quality and plumbing efficiency.



Benefits of Professional Plumbing Services for Water Quality

  • Healthier Water:
    • Removes harmful chemicals, bacteria, and heavy metals from your water supply.
  • Better Taste and Odor:
    • Eliminates unpleasant smells or tastes caused by chlorine, sulfur, or sediment.
  • Protects Plumbing Systems:
    • Prevents mineral buildup and corrosion, extending the lifespan of pipes and fixtures.
  • Compliance with Safety Standards:
    • Ensures your water meets local health and safety regulations.

Tips for Maintaining High Water Quality

  1. Schedule Regular Plumbing Inspections:
    • Have a professional plumber inspect your system annually to identify and address water quality issues early.
  1. Clean or Replace Filters:
    • Replace water filters in your filtration system as recommended by the manufacturer to maintain optimal performance.
  1. Flush Faucets Periodically:
    • Run cold water through faucets for a few minutes to clear out potential contaminants from stagnant water.
  1. Test Your Water Regularly:
    • Use a water testing kit or hire a plumber to analyze your water for contaminants and determine if treatment is needed.
